Note about printing scroll saw patterns. If your print is not the correct size it is possible that the scaling is set to (Fit to page). You have to set the print driver to (Actual size) for many patterns to print correctly.

PDF printing can be confusing. The original PDF viewer is Adobe Acrobat Reader DC. A few years ago the modern browsers started including their own PDF viewers. These often have fewer features than Adobe Acrobat Reader DC. One feature that can be missing is the (Actual size) print.

If your browser has trouble printing PDF files correctly then I recommend using Adobe Acrobat Reader DC for printing my patterns. Disabling the browsers built-in PDF viewer is done in the settings but it is different for different browsers. You may need to Google the instruction to set Adobe Acrobat Reader DC as your browsers default viewer. 

Workshop Hearing Protections is Important.

I am not a sound specialist. These are just my observations and experiences. You should consult your doctor for expert medical advice.

I spent a good part of my 37-year career working around loud machinery. For many years I worked in my workshop without hearing protection. As a result, I have a significant hearing loss. I am most affected when there are several people talking in a large group.  My audiologist has suggested hearing aids but I have not made that decision yet. 

Hearing protection is something that many woodworkers do not consider until the damage is done. OSHA publishes guidelines for when hearing protection is needed. They are based on how long the exposure is for a given dB. 

The readings below are with the tools not under load. These are idle readings and they are already at levels where prolonged exposure will cause hearing damage. When the tools are put under load they can get considerably louder.

I now use hearing protection for all the high noise generating machines in my shop. I have four over-ear hearing muffs. I keep them spread out around the shop so they are always handy. I can never get my lost hearing back but I sure don't want to make it worse.

 Table Saw MAX 89.1dB

 Disc Sander MAx dB 94.5

Planer MAX dB 108.8

Router Table MAX dB 94.5


TABLE G-16 - PERMISSIBLE NOISE EXPOSURES (1)
______________________________________________________________
                            
  Duration per day, hours   | Sound level dBA slow response
_____________________________________________________________
                            
8...........................  90
6...........................  92
4...........................  95
3...........................  97
2...........................  100
1 1/2 ......................102
1...........................  105
1/2 ........................ 110
1/4  or less..............115
___________________________________________________________
 Footnote(1) When the daily noise exposure is composed of two or
more periods of noise exposure of different levels, their combined
effect should be considered, rather than the individual effect of
each. If the sum of the following fractions: C(1)/T(1) + C(2)/T(2)
C(n)/T(n) exceeds unity, then, the mixed exposure should be
considered to exceed the limit value. Cn indicates the total time of
exposure at a specified noise level, and Tn indicates the total time
of exposure permitted at that level. Exposure to impulsive or impact
noise should not exceed 140 dB peak sound pressure level.
